Transaction 28bba8c97aaca17d35d5917e67553fb4004215f70171bc5fdfa9d30376290afb
1 Input
1 Output
-
28bba8c97aaca17d35d5917e67553fb4004215f70171bc5fdfa9d30376290afb:0
- value
- 9182860
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f67515adadaa988ba519a1affa07bb4e8ec48261 OP_EQUAL
- address
- 3QAAQvLCmm8zbw7BDHvg2UqP2Kdj6JRgMD